Accessing Public Records: A Step-by-Phase Search Strategy

Delving into public records can be a valuable tool for research, investigations, or even personal inquiries. However, navigating the labyrinthine world of these documents can often feel daunting. To streamline your search and uncover the information you need, follow this comprehensive step-by-phase guide.

First, precisely define your search objectives. What type of records are you seeking? Which individuals are involved? What timeframe are you interested in? The more refined your criteria, the less time-consuming your search will be.

  • Pinpoint the relevant government agency. Public records are often housed at the local, state, or federal level. For example, real estate transactions might be held by a county clerk's office, while court filings are typically managed by the judicial system.
  • Utilize online databases and search engines. Many jurisdictions now offer digital access to their public records. These platforms often provide advanced search features that allow you to narrow your results based on keywords, dates, and other parameters.
  • Submit a formal request if necessary. Some records may not be immediately accessible online or require a formal application. Be prepared to provide detailed information about your search purpose and any relevant identifying factors.
  • Scrutinize the retrieved records meticulously. Ensure that the information is accurate, complete, and relevant to your needs. Cross-reference data with other sources if possible to verify its authenticity.

Keep in mind that public records laws vary from jurisdiction to jurisdiction. Familiarize yourself with the specific regulations governing the release and access of information in your area.
